Replace the Fuse

ATTENTION: Never install, remove, or wire power supplies unless power has been switched off.
Follow these steps to replace a blown fuse.
1. Remove Compact I/O system power to correct conditions that are causing the short
circuit.
2. To remove the fuse housing cover, place a slotted screwdriver under the tab.
3. Use a fuse puller or similar device to remove the fuse.
Use care so that the printed circuit board and surrounding electronics are not damaged.
Fuse Housing Cover
4. Replace the front access fuse by centering the replacement fuse over the fuse clip and
pressing down.

If you use a tool to press the fuse in place, apply pressure to only the metal end caps, not
to the center of the fuse.
5. Replace the fuse housing cover.
6. Restore Compact I/O system power.
